About

Strawberry Fields is an indica-dominant hybrid sitting at roughly 80% indica and 20% sativa, with genetics traced to unknown landrace descent. Exact parentage has not been formally documented, but the strain's profile reflects the stable, relaxation-leaning character commonly associated with indica-heavy landrace lineages. THC typically tests between 18% and 22%, putting it in a range that experienced consumers will find substantive without being extreme. The terpene profile is built around limonene, myrcene, and caryophyllene. That combination tends to produce an aroma that runs citrus-forward with berry sweetness underneath, and the flavor follows a similar path — citrus and berry notes up front, with pine and earthy tones rounding out the finish. It's a fairly layered profile for a strain of unknown lineage, and the sweet character carries through from smell to taste reasonably well. Users commonly report relaxing effects. This aligns with the heavily indica-weighted genetics, and at the THC levels this strain typically produces, that relaxation tends to be noticeable. Nothing unusual stands out in the commonly reported experience — Strawberry Fields delivers what most indica-dominant hybrids with this terpene mix would be expected to deliver. From a cultivation standpoint, the strain is rated moderate in difficulty, which means it's not the right starting point for a complete beginner but is manageable for a grower with a season or two of experience. Flowering runs 8 to 9 weeks, which is a fairly standard window for indica-leaning varieties. Yield potential is described as moderate to high, so growers who dial in their environment and feeding program should be rewarded. No specific environmental preferences or training notes are documented, so standard practices for indica-dominant plants apply. Where Strawberry Fields carries particular significance is in its role as a parent strain. It is recorded as part of the genetic foundation of Strawberry Cough, a well-known cultivar in its own right. That contribution to a strain with Strawberry Cough's recognition gives Strawberry Fields a place in cannabis breeding history that extends beyond its own characteristics. For collectors and breeders interested in landrace-influenced genetics with demonstrated ability to pass along appealing flavor traits, it represents a useful reference point in understanding where some of those characteristics originate.
